On your computer screen, you put a lot of important information and don't want others to see it every time you get up to go out to get water or do personal work. At this time, you can operate to lock your computer screen . Again, when you sit down, just open it and enter your login password (if any).

* Use the keyboard shortcut Windows + L

Press the Windows + L key combination at the same time and the computer screen will immediately lock and you can comfortably get up and go do other things.

* Use the keyboard shortcut Ctrl + Alt + Delete

When pressing the 3 shortcut keys Ctrl + Alt + Delete at the same time, the system will display a menu with different options. Select Lock to lock the screen.

Method 2: Create a shortcut to lock the computer screen

Step 1: Right-click on the main screen, select New > Shortcut

Step 2: A new window appears, type in the following syntax: rundll32.exe user32.dll,LockWorkStation and press Next

Step 3: Next, you proceed to name this shortcut. For example, LockScreen and then click Finish to finish.

That's it. From now on, just click on the shortcut you just created and the desktop screen will automatically lock immediately.

Method 3. Lock the computer screen from the Start Menu

Step 1: Click on the Windows icon in the bottom left corner of the screen Step 2: Click on your Windows account avatar Step 3: Select Lock (screen lock)

Method 4. Lock the computer screen automatically via Screen Saver

Step 1: Click on the Windows icon and select Settings

Step 2: Select Lock screen and select Screen timeout settings

Step 3. In the Screen section , you choose the number of minutes that the computer screen will automatically lock by clicking the down arrow and selecting the desired number of minutes.

Method 5. Use Command Prompt to lock the computer screen

Step 1: From the Windows window , enter command prompt , then click on the program to open it.

Step 2: Enter the command line Rundll32.exe user32.dll,LockWorkStation , then type Enter , the screen will immediately be locked.
